$273.59
Item#: RM1-7623
Brand: Compatible Parts
Availability: In Stock
Add to cart
Wishlist
$108.33
Item#: RM1-7615
Brand: Compatible Parts
Availability: In Stock
Add to cart
Wishlist
$104.99
Item#: CE278A
Brand: unbranded
Availability: In Stock
Add to cart
Wishlist